**Day One Checklist — Fire-Drill Roll Call**

☐ Find your assembly point! At Copperleigh House it's the gravel yard by the old clock tower. When the alarm sounds, head out via the nearest stairwell and check in with your floor warden — that's how roll call works here, no apps, just faces. To re-enter the building afterwards, you'll need your badge and the code below.

door code, kawip-bagap: bdg-HQEWH-4

# Constants for Pinchbeck's EXIF scrubber.
# Strips location, serial, and timestamp tags from uploaded images
# before they hit the public CDN. Batch size and timeout were tuned
# against the Marrowgate fixture set; don't raise them without
# re-running the soak test. Current values are defined below.

limits module of kahag-fajop:
QUOTAS = {
    "wenwyn": 10,
    "zorath": 1,
}

- [ ] Step 7: Archive cold storage buckets (Glacierline tier). Confirm both ceremony witnesses are present, verify bucket manifests match the Oxbow ledger, then seal the archive key shares. Plugin authors may observe but not handle shares. Once sealed, the archive index itself is encrypted and can only be reopened with the passphrase below.

vault phrase of badup-hahig = tamael-aldael-kelmir-istael-fenok-istwyn-tamius-jorath-oliion